The Bachelor of Science in Information Technology program focuses on the design of technological information systems, including computing systems, as solutions to business and research data and communications support needs. The program includes instruction in the principles of computer hardware and software components, algorithms, databases, telecommunications, user tactics, application testing, and human interface design. Upon graduation, students will be able to: Plan, construct, troubleshoot, and maintain enterprise network infrastructures. Design, configure, and maintain a cloud infrastructure. Equip with the skills in protection and application of network security, compliance/operational intelligence, threats, access control, and cryptography. Use and apply current technical concepts and practices in the core information technologies. Through a conceptual understanding, apply technological skills in hardware, networking, security, cloud computing, database, web development, IT project management and research to analyze and solve problems.

United States · F-1 student visa
Most academic students use F-1 with Form I-20, SEVIS fee, and a consular interview. Maintain full-time enrollment and status rules.
Post-study work
Optional Practical Training (OPT) / STEM OPT · up to ~36 months
Eligible F-1 graduates may apply for OPT (commonly up to 12 months). Some STEM degrees qualify for an additional STEM OPT extension (often up to 24 months more).
